Selection of the inertia of the particles used for the optical diagnostics of high-velocity gas flows

Abstract: The selection of the inertial parameters (density, size) of tracer particles used for the diagnostics of high-speed gas flows is considered. A relation has been obtained from an analysis to find the velocity of tracer particles under the assumption that the aerodynamic drag coefficient of the particles is equal to unity. Estimates of the times and lengths of the acceleration of particles with different inertia in a gas flow moving at a constant speed are made.
